Strengths:Low fat, low cholesteral and low sodium with a fair amount of carbs and protein. Easy-to-open wrapper.
Weaknesses:Very dry - take with fluid! Not as tasty as PowerBar Harvest bars.
Similar Products Used:PowerBar, PowerBar Harvest
Bike Setup:Trek carbon road bike with Campy Veloce triple
Bottom Line:Good taste (not too sweet) with high nutritional value. Dry composition requires that you drink plenty of fluids when eating them. Satisfying and filling; I am a full-time student and routinely eat these for lunch - I can last the afternoon until 5 pm without having to sneak any sugary snacks. Easy to take along on rides, and they don't melt like chocolate-covered bars.
